Wine & WatchTower Library

Version Wine
0.9.9 - 0.9.12
0.9.13 - 0.9.26
0.9.27 - 0.9.43
0.9.44 - 0.9.52
0.9.53 - 0.9.57

 

WatchTower Library 2007

Depuis la version 2007 de la Bibliothèque WatchTower et de la version 0.9.53, j'ai remarqué - les remontées que me font certains utilisateurs le confirment - qu'il est plus délicat d'installer celle-ci ...

 

Il existe néanmoins, apparement, deux méthodes pour y arriver ; la première que je trouve explicite, et une seconde ...

 

Préférez-la première méthode - à mon avis ...

Méthode explicite

Supprimez tout répertoire d'installation précédente de wine - ou renommez-le ...

 

Téléchargez manuellement ou par le biais de votre système la dernière version de wine puis installez-la !

 

Téléchargez le paquet librement redistribuable de Microsoft suivant :

Microsoft Visual C++ 2005
x86,
x64,
ia64.

 

Puis, installez-le avec Wine : wine vcredist_version.exe
où version est le nom de votre version selon votre système, soit x86, x64 ou ia64 ...

 

Ceci étant fait, vous n'avez plus qu'à double-cliquer sur l'exécutable Setup.exe de votre cdrom de la bibliothèque pour démarrer l'installation, ou à le lancer en mode console :
wine /media/cdrom/Setup.exe

Sous Xandros, avec l'Eee PC, il faut le lancer ainsi : wine /media/DVD\ A\ DS8AZP/data/Setup.exe

 

L'installation étant terminée, il vous fait régler les problèmes de la gestion des polices, des infos-bulles - pour cette dernière, tout particulièrement lire les sections de modification du registre ou de la configuration de wine ...

Méthode par script Easy Installer

Pour information, il existe un exécutable nommé Easy Installer qui s'occupe complètement de toute la phase d'installation, en vous installant tout ce qui est nécessaire au bon fonctionnement de la bibliothèque WatchTower ...

 

Cet installeur se trouve sur Sourceforge.

 

Celui-ci s'installera dans un sous-répertoire .winewtlib.0.9.36.2 dans votre répertoire personnel ... et vous permettra de lancer la bibliothéque à partir du menu 'Applications', par la création d'un sous-menu 'WatchTower Library'.

 

Si vous désirez installer la bibliothéque Watchtower avec ce script, veuillez suivre les indications de ce tutoriel !

 

WatchTower Library - années précédentes

Installez la Bibliothèque WatchTower, en mode console :
WINEDLLOVERRIDES="ole32,oleaut32,rpcrt4,comctl32=n,b" wine /media/cdrom/Setup.exe
et, répondez aux questions qui vous sont posées lors de l'installation, en cliquant sur Suivant

 

Une fois l'installation terminée, créez un raccourci vers votre bureau, si celui-ci n'a pas été créé :
ln -sfn .wine/drive_c/Program\ Files/Watchtower/Watchtower\ Library\ AAAA/f/wtlib.exe ~/Desktop/WTLibAAAA est le numéro de l'année de la bibliothèque que vous cherchez à installer ;
puis associer ce raccourci avec wine, par un clic droit de votre souris sur le raccourci nouvellement créé, sur votre bureau.

 

Ensuite, copiez tous les fichiers du répertoire .wine/drive_c/Program\ Files/Watchtower/MEPSCommon dans le répertoire .wine/drive_c/windows/system/ cette fois-ci !

 

Il ne vous reste plus qu'à vous servir de celle-ci, en cliquant sur l'icône correspondant, sur votre bureau ... bonne lecture !

Anciennes procédures d'installation

Avant la version 0.9.27, il était nécessaire de récupérer l'outil DCOM98 de Microsoft. Celui-ci ne sert qu'à l'installation...
Ouvrez une fenêtre console et tapez :
cd /votre_repertoire_de_telechargement
WINEDLLOVERRIDES="ole32=n" wine DCOM98.exe

 

Depuis la version 0.9.13, il n'est plus besoin de télécharger la bibliothèque de liaison dynamique comctl32.dll, celle-ci est en effet intégrée, sauf pour avoir les info-bulles.

 

Problèmes

Installation ne démarre pas

Il est possible que l'installation, après avoir cliqué sur le fichier Setup.exe ne démarre pas ...
Supprimez votre répertoire personnel .wine ou renommez-le différemment.
Relancez winecfg en paramètrant juste sur Windows XP, puis redémarrez l'install.

Installation plantée

Message d'erreur : Could not create

Le processus de wine vient de se bloquer, essayez de le tuer en lancant cette commande :
wineserver -k
cela aura pour effet d'arrêter tous les programmes wine en cours ; il vous faudra donc relancer l'installation de la bibliothèque !

Caractères

Vous pouvez rencontrer des problèmes de caractères absents ou incompris, tel que les "M" ou "*" spécifiants une référence.
Si c'est le cas, téléchargez les polices .ttf suivantes et copiez-les dans votre répertoire personnel ~/.wine/drive_c/windows/fonts.
Vous pouvez aussi y mettre toute autre police TrueType, de préférence sous une licence libre, ou de libre diffusion...

 

Icônes

Pour avoir l'icône représentant la WatchTower Library, ou Reader, sur le lien permettant de lancer l'application, faites un clic droit sur le lien en question, choisir "Propriétés", restez sur l'onglet "Général", cliquez sur le carré à côté du champ "Nom".

 

Dans la fenêtre "Sélectionnez une icône personnalisée", si vous n'êtes pas dans votre répertoire personnel, cliquez dessus dans la partie gauche "Raccourcis" de la fenêtre, puis dans la partie droite "Nom", cliquez sur:
.wine > drive_c > windows > temp et choisissez l'icône dont le nom termine par _wtlib.0.xpm.

 

Puis cliquez sur le bouton 'Ouvrir', puis sur le bouton 'Fermer' de la fenêtre "Propriétés".

Infos bulles

Pour avoir les infos bulles, il vous faut installer une bibliothèque comctl32.dll native, livrée et fournie par la société Microsoft, avec son système d'exploitation Windows - de préférence XP - et l'installer dans le répertoire ~/.wine/drive_c/windows/system32 en lieu et place de celle fournie par le projet Wine.
Relatif à l'usage de la librairie comctl32.dll, veuillez lire les remarques ci-dessous sur le copyright Microsoft, et prenez vos responsabilités.

 

Cela étant dit, il ne vous reste plus qu'à implémenter la modification suivante :
faites-la soit en modifiant directement le fichier user.reg, soit par winecfg - cela revient au-même.

Modification fichier registre user.reg

Éditez le fichier ~/.wine/user.reg, et à la section '[Software\\Wine\\DllOverrides]', ajoutez "comctl32"="native,builtin".
Si ladite section n'existe pas, créez-la !

Modification winecfg

Lancez winecfg, cliquez sur l'onglet 'Bibliothèques', choisissez 'comctl32' dans la liste déroulante 'Nouveau surclassage', puis appuyez sur le bouton '[ Ajouter ]'. Ceci étant fait, dans le champ 'Surclassage existant' vous devriez voir 'comctl32 (native, inclue)'.

Autres fichiers à modifier !

=> Depuis la version 0.9.53 de wine et la version 2007 de la bibliothèque, il est nécessaire de renommer le fichier suivant ~/.wine/drive_c/windows/winsxs/manifests/x86_microsoft.windows. common-controls_6595b64144ccf1df_6.0.*.*_none_deadbeef.manifest si malgré les modifications ci-dessus, les info-bulles ne fonctionnent toujours pas :
mv ~/.wine/drive_c/windows/winsxs/manifests/x86_microsoft.windows.common-controls_6595b64144ccf1df_6.0.*.*_none_deadbeef.manifest ~/.wine/drive_c/windows/winsxs/manifests/x86_microsoft.windows.common-controls_6595b64144ccf1df_6.0.*.*_none_deadbeef.manifest.bad

 

=> Pour les années antérieures à la bibliothéque version 2007, depuis la version 0.9.44 de wine, et à cause de ce bogue, il se peut que malgré tout que les info-bulles ne fonctionnent pas.
Dans ce cas, il vous faut créer le répertoire suivant : ~/.wine/drive_c/windows/winsxs/x86_microsoft.windows.common-controls_6595b64144ccf1df_6.0.0.0_none_deadbeef puis copier dedans la bibiliothèque comctl32.dll.

 

DLL

[1]Il est possible que pendant l'installation, vous ayez des messages d'erreurs concernant des bibliothéques de liaison dynamique dites .dll qui ne peuvent être copiés ... notez-l(a|es) et cliquez donc sur le bouton 'ignorer' de l'interface d'installation, afin de terminer celle-ci.
Ceci étant fait, il vous faudra rechercher la bibliothéque correspondante sur un de ces sites :

 

 

Puis l'installer dans le répertoire personnel ~/.wine/drive_c/windows/system/

Néanmoins, faites attention aux droits d'utilisation sur certaines bibliothèques dynamiques. Veuillez lire à ce propos la section ci-dessous "Copyright".

 

PS : testé sous Ubuntu.

 

Copyright

Wine

Wine est un logiciel libre sous licence LGPL. Pour plus d'informations, veuillez lire cette page d'information.

Microsoft

Concernant l'usage de produits et logiciels de Microsoft veuillez-vous référez à la page d'autorisation d'utilisation de logiciels.

 

WatchTower

Les outils WatchTower Library et WatchTower Reader sont la propriété de WatchTower Society.
Celle-ci n'apporte aucun support pour les systèmes d'exploitations informatiques GNU/Linux.
De plus, il faut être témoin de Jéhovah pour les obtenir et les utiliser.

Remerciements

Des remerciements particuliers à Franck Corner, pour son aide un temps donné, pour les informations restituées sur le wiki Wine-Wiki.org, pour le site de Mr.Mepis ...

 

Pagination

| Icône du logiciel Watchtower_library |>>

 

 

^ Haut de page ^

Plan du site :: Date de mise-à-jour de cette page : 12-03-2008 :: Atom :: RSS :: Sitemap :: e-mail ::

Copyright 2004-2008 © EBNH Conception - CNIL : 841395 -

XHTML 1.0, CSS 2.1, WAI

HowTo 'Mémoire Grise Libérée' :
Hormis la documentation propre à nVidia ...
tout ce site est placé sous Licence Libre GNU/FDL...

Partenaires : aGeNUx : Evinux : Knoppix-fr : Linucie : Diaporama "Ad~Myre" : Odt2Xhtml : Xhtml2Pdf :